如何在CAD中学习使用Web服务?

在当今数字化时代,CAD(计算机辅助设计)已经成为工程师和设计师们不可或缺的工具。随着技术的不断发展,Web服务在CAD中的应用也越来越广泛。本文将详细介绍如何在CAD中学习使用Web服务,帮助您更好地利用这一功能提高工作效率。

一、了解CAD与Web服务的关系

  1. CAD简介

CAD(Computer-Aided Design)即计算机辅助设计,是一种利用计算机进行设计的技术。它可以帮助设计师在二维或三维空间中创建、修改和优化产品图纸。CAD软件具有丰富的功能,如绘图、建模、仿真等,广泛应用于机械、建筑、电子等领域。


  1. Web服务简介

Web服务是一种基于网络的服务,它允许不同的应用程序通过互联网进行通信和交互。Web服务使用标准化的协议和接口,使得不同平台、不同语言编写的应用程序能够相互访问和调用。


  1. CAD与Web服务的关系

随着互联网技术的发展,越来越多的CAD软件开始支持Web服务。通过Web服务,用户可以将CAD模型和设计数据上传到云端,实现远程访问和共享。同时,Web服务还可以与其他应用程序集成,实现数据交换和协同设计。

二、学习使用CAD中Web服务的步骤

  1. 选择合适的CAD软件

首先,您需要选择一款支持Web服务的CAD软件。目前市面上常见的CAD软件有AutoCAD、SolidWorks、CATIA等。在选择软件时,请确保软件具备以下特点:

(1)支持Web服务:软件需要提供Web服务的接口,方便用户进行远程访问和共享。

(2)功能丰富:软件应具备基本的绘图、建模、仿真等功能,满足您的设计需求。

(3)易于学习:软件应具备友好的用户界面和丰富的学习资源,方便您快速上手。


  1. 了解Web服务的概念和原理

在开始使用Web服务之前,您需要了解以下概念和原理:

(1)Web服务协议:如SOAP(Simple Object Access Protocol)、REST(Representational State Transfer)等。

(2)Web服务接口:包括API(应用程序编程接口)、WSDL(Web服务描述语言)等。

(3)数据格式:如XML(可扩展标记语言)、JSON(JavaScript Object Notation)等。


  1. 学习Web服务的操作方法

以下是一些学习使用CAD中Web服务的操作方法:

(1)访问Web服务接口:在CAD软件中,通常可以通过“插件”、“扩展”或“工具”等方式访问Web服务接口。

(2)调用Web服务:在接口中,您可以根据需要调用不同的Web服务,如上传、下载、查询等。

(3)处理返回结果:Web服务调用完成后,会返回相应的结果。您需要根据返回结果进行处理,如解析XML/JSON数据、显示图形等。


  1. 实践与总结

学习使用CAD中Web服务需要大量的实践。以下是一些建议:

(1)阅读官方文档:熟悉CAD软件和Web服务的官方文档,了解相关功能和操作方法。

(2)参加培训课程:报名参加相关的培训课程,学习专业的操作技巧。

(3)实际操作:在实际项目中,尝试使用Web服务进行数据共享和协同设计。

(4)总结经验:在实践过程中,不断总结经验,提高自己的技能水平。

三、Web服务在CAD中的应用场景

  1. 远程协作设计

通过Web服务,团队成员可以远程访问和共享CAD模型,实现协同设计。这有助于提高设计效率,降低沟通成本。


  1. 数据交换与集成

Web服务可以将CAD数据与其他应用程序进行集成,实现数据交换。例如,将CAD模型导入到BIM(建筑信息模型)软件中,进行建筑设计和施工。


  1. 云端存储与备份

利用Web服务,可以将CAD模型存储在云端,实现数据备份和共享。这有助于防止数据丢失,提高数据安全性。


  1. 个性化定制

通过Web服务,用户可以根据自己的需求,定制CAD软件的功能和界面。例如,开发自己的插件,扩展CAD软件的功能。

总之,学习使用CAD中Web服务对于设计师和工程师来说具有重要意义。通过掌握Web服务,您可以提高工作效率,实现数据共享和协同设计。希望本文能为您提供帮助,祝您在CAD中学习使用Web服务取得成功。

猜你喜欢:PLM软件